Export of dairy products of the Russian Federation to Kazakhstan exceeded $100 million – Agroexport

Since the beginning of the year, Russian enterprises have exported dairy products to Kazakhstan at more than $100 million, according to the data of the Federal State Budgetary Institution Agroexport.

This country leads by a large margin from other top importers (Ukraine - $50 million, Belarus - $35 million, USA - $23.3 million, Uzbekistan - $14.8 million).

The main exporting regions are Moscow and Moscow region ($170 million), Rostov region ($36.78) and Krasnodar region ($11.32 million).

‘It is possible that the growth rate will decrease next season. As many experts note, animal husbandry is in the red in terms of profitability this year. Some enterprises are closing, and it is unlikely that it will be possible to reverse the decline in the number of cattle,’ commented Alexander Gavrilenko, the author of the Gavrilenko Agroprom Zen channel. ‘It is also possible that in 2021 restrictions on the export of milk, quotas or duties will be introduced. Of course, the president set the task of doubling agricultural export, and in the agricultural export Development Strategy, priority is given to products with a high processing rate. However, the "stability" of the domestic market remains an absolute priority for the state.
